  • FDA Recommends Recall for Eye Drops From Target, CVS, Rite Aid Due to Possible Contamination

    By Monroe Hammond Verified| Everyday Health Verified The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is warning consumers to avoid over-the-counter lubricating eye drops sold by several major retailers, including Target, Rite Aid, and CVS, because of possible bacterial contamination that could lead to infections, partial vision loss, or blindness. While brick-and-mortar retailers are pulling the affected products from shelves, some of the eye drops may still be available for purchase online and should be avoided.
